Basic Information of Protein
UniProt ID C1QL4_HUMAN
UniProt AC Q86Z23
Protein Name Complement C1q-like protein 4
Gene Name C1QL4
Organism Homo sapiens (Human).
Sequence Length 238
Subcellular Localization Secreted.
Protein Description May regulate the number of excitatory synapses that are formed on hippocampus neurons. Has no effect on inhibitory synapses (By similarity). May inhibit adipocyte differentiation at an early stage of the process (By similarity)..
